Today, we roll into a story about community, connection, and a love of the game. 🎳
In collaboration with Zayed Sports City, we spotlight the athletes and grassroots groups shaping Abu Dhabi’s women’s and community sports scene. And there’s no better example than the Abu Dhabi Filipino Bowling Club, more than a league for nearly four decades, it’s a second family for generations of Filipinos in the UAE.
Recorded at the Khalifa International Bowling Center at Zayed Sports City, we chat with Sarah Ociones, a long-time resident, former UAE National Team bowler, and central figure in the club. She shares how bowling went from a fun family activity to international competition, how the club has grown, and the ways it brings people together - through tournaments, charity, and sheer love of the game.
Whether you’re a bowler or just curious about how sport creates community, this episode is full of laughter, inspiration, and stories that make Abu Dhabi feel like home.
